데이터베이스 사용

동키·2022년 11월 29일
0

데이터베이스 연결 -> 필요한 구문 수행 -> 데이터베이스 연결 해제

데이터베이스 연결을 미리 해두고 필요할때마다 구문만 수행하고 애플리케이션이 종료될 때 연결 종료 하는 등 다양한 방법이 있으나 추구해야할 방향은 커넥션풀을 활용하는 것이다.

(커넥션 풀 : 데이터베이스와 연결된 커넥션을 미리 만들어 놓고 이를 pool로 관리하는 것이다. 즉, 필요할 때마다 커넥션 풀의 커넥션을 이용하고 반환하는 기법이다. )

//node 데이터 베이스의 item 컬렉션에 존재하는 모든 데이터를 리턴
app. ? (' ',(req,res) => {})

? = 파라미터 get, post 방식 사용 판단
데이터를 숨겨야하냐 (post) /안숨겨도 되냐 (get)
보내는 데이터가 크다 (post) /작다 (get)

ex) 데이터 목록 보낼때, 페이지 설정할 때 = get
파일을 받을 때 = post

' ' 네이밍 부여 판단
= 무엇을 수행할 지 직관적으로 알 수 있어야 함

부분적으로 가져오는 것이 없다면 'item'
뒷쪽에서 부분을 가져오는 일이 생긴다면 일단 'item/all'

profile
안녕하시와리

0개의 댓글